Understanding Winter Haven's Climate

Winter Haven is located in Polk County, Florida, where the climate is characterized by high humidity and temperatures that rarely drop below 40°F (4°C). The rain season from June to September brings heavy rainfall, which can wash away fertilizers and nutrients, leaving your lawn vulnerable. In addition, the sandy soil common in this region requires specialized fertilization techniques.

Choosing the Right Fertilizer for Winter Haven Lawns

When selecting a fertilizer for your Winter Haven lawn, consider the following factors:

* Nitrogen: Essential for healthy growth, nitrogen is often lacking in Florida's sandy soils. * Phosphorus: Encourages root development and flowering, but can be toxic to waterways if overapplied. * Potassium: Promotes overall plant health and resistance to disease.

Look for a fertilizer with a balanced N-P-K ratio (e.g., 10-10-10) and consider organic options like compost or manure-based fertilizers.

Timing is Everything: Seasonal Fertilization in Winter Haven

To get the most out of your lawn fertilization, apply at the right time:

* Spring: Apply a balanced fertilizer in late March to early April to promote new growth. * Summer: Use a high-nitrogen fertilizer in July and August to compensate for nutrient loss due to heavy rainfall. * Fall: Apply a slow-release fertilizer in September to October to promote root development and winter hardiness.

Practical Tips for Winter Haven Homeowners

* Test your soil: Before fertilizing, test your soil to determine its pH level and nutrient content. * Water wisely: Avoid overwatering, which can lead to nutrient loss and root rot. * Maintain your mower: Keep your mower blade sharp to prevent tearing the grass and promoting disease.
